gpt-image-2.5 reportedly live in ChatGPT but absent from API, access unclear
andpoul · x · 2026-09-09
Developer andpoul says he hasn't been tweeting about gpt-image-2.5 because it isn't showing up for him on the API yet, and it's hard to tell which model ChatGPT is actually using. He's asking whether anyone has gotten access.
Reads as an unverified signal that OpenAI's next-gen image model gpt-image-2.5 may already be partially live in ChatGPT, though the API rollout hasn't reached everyone.
